I have decided I am going to get my real estate license. The only decision I have left is whether or not to take the class in person, or if I should take an online course allowed by the state of Indiana.

I was wondering what some of your opinions are as far as which route you would suggest to someone new to the industry and looking to start my investing career?

Thanks in advance!

@Andre Jernigan I can't speak to the class in IN but I took the class online. I was concerned that I would not do well as I a have not been successful at online courses in the past simply due to my learning style. That being said anything worth doing takes work and stretching yourself. I will say the flexibility to do it in my spare time was nice. It was basically a bunch of reading.
